Overview of Vietnam Visas for Indians

There are several types of visas available for Indian citizens looking to travel to Vietnam:
- Tourist Visa – For tourism and sightseeing purposes. Valid for 30 days and can be extended.
- Business Visa – For business trips, meetings, conferences etc. Valid for 3 months and can be extended.
- E-Visa – An online visa that can be used for both tourism and business. Valid for 30 days.
- Visa on Arrival – For those who need to travel urgently. Must apply for pre-approval letter before arrival.
The visa requirements and application process vary slightly depending on which type you apply for. However, all visas require a valid passport, completed application form, passport photos, and various fees.

How to Apply for a Vietnam Visa as an Indian

Tourist and Business Visas
The easiest way to apply for a tourist or business visa is through the Vietnamese Embassy in India. You will need to submit your application in person along with all required documents such as passport, photos, and fees. Processing time is around 5 business days.
Alternatively, you can use an online visa service provider to handle the application process for you. They will submit the application to the embassy on your behalf and have it couriered back to you once approved. This costs more but is very convenient.
E-Visa
Vietnam offers an electronic visa (e-visa) program which allows visitors to apply online and receive visa approval via email. E-visas are valid for 30 days and can be used for tourism or business.
To apply, visit the official Vietnam Immigration Department website. You will need to complete the online form and upload supporting documents. Approval is generally received within 3 working days.
Visa on Arrival
This method involves obtaining pre-approval from a Vietnamese travel agency, who will provide you with an approval letter. You present this letter at immigration control when you arrive at major airports in Vietnam to receive your visa.
Visas issued on arrival are valid for 30 days. Be aware that this method comes with some uncertainties, so it’s best for those who need to travel urgently and don’t have time to apply in advance.
Vietnam Visa Requirements for Indian Citizens
All visa applicants from India must meet the following requirements:
- Valid passport – Must have at least 6 months validity remaining
- Completed application form – Forms can be downloaded online
- Passport photos – 2 photos, 4cm x 6cm, no glasses or headwear
- Visa fees – Varies by visa type, usually around $25 – $135 USD
- Return ticket – Proof of onward or return travel
- Hotel bookings – Confirmed hotel reservations for duration of stay
- Bank statement – Showing proof of sufficient funds
- Employment letter – For business visas, a letter from your employer
- Additional documents – Certain visa types may require extra documents
Be sure to check the specific requirements for the visa type you are applying for. Having all documents ready will help avoid delays in processing your visa application.

Tips for urgently getting a Vietnam eVisa from India in 2023:
- Start the process early. The Vietnam eVisa application process can take up to 3 business days to complete, so it is important to start the process as early as possible, especially if you are traveling on short notice.
- Make sure you have all the required documentation. The required documentation for a Vietnam eVisa includes a passport-sized photo, a scanned copy of your passport, and a valid credit or debit card. You may also need to provide additional documentation, such as a proof of onward travel or a letter of invitation, depending on your nationality and purpose of travel.
- Pay the eVisa fee online. The eVisa fee for Indians is $25 USD. You can pay the fee online using a credit or debit card.
- Submit your application online. You can submit your eVisa application online through the Vietnam Immigration Department website.
- Check the status of your application regularly. You can check the status of your eVisa application online through the Vietnam Immigration Department website. Once your application is approved, you will receive an email notification with your eVisa.
- Print out your eVisa and bring it with you when you travel. You will need to present your eVisa to immigration officials upon arrival in Vietnam.
